HP India on June 25 announced the HP Pavilion x360 with digital pen support at a starting price of Rs 50,347. As an introductory offer, the notebook comes bundled with offers worth Rs 34,000 that include Beo Play (B&O) speaker, extended warranty for two years, one-year accidental damage protection, McAfee Internet Security software, theft insurance and PinePerks gift vouchers worth Rs 2,500 valid across e-commerce and travel portals such as Amazon, Flipkart, Make My Trip, etc.

The Pavilion x360 is powered by 8th generation Intel core processors. It also sports Intel Optane memory, which is claimed to improve overall system performance by 28 per cent, therefore helps to open large media projects by up to 4.1 times faster and launch emails up to 5.8 times faster. Weighing 1.68 kg, the laptop comes with a fingerprint reader as a biometric tool for secure login.

In term of features, the notebook sports a 14-inch screen and features Bang and Olufsen (B&O Play)-tuned dual speakers with HP Audio Boost technology. The laptop sports a 5-megapixel camera with 120-degree wide viewing lens. The notebook is claimed to have 11 hours on-battery time, and comes with HP fast charge technology.
